I’m Rebecca Smith, your podcast host, and High Performance Coach. I’m Director of Complete Performance Coaching and founder of The #PerformHappy Community.Maybe you’re a gymnast with a fear of going backwards. A swimmer who can’t seem to go any faster. Or a parent who is clueless about how to help your child succeed. You might be stepping up to tougher competition and looking to raise your game. Whether you're struggling with a mental block, or you just had the best season of your life, this podcast is for you.Kids need resources to deal with the pressure of competition, but they don’t necessarily want it to be their coach or parents.I teach parents, coaches, and adolescent/teen athletes of all abilities how to achieve their personal best. These are the tips and mental toughness strategies that my clients tell me help them most.I also provide insights for parents and coaches who want to support their kids and their teams.Performing well is a blend of hard work, skill and mental toughness. I’ll teach you how to use all 3 to be the best athlete you can, and have FUN competing in your sport. Mental skills translate to all areas of your life. When kids learn skills to cope with stress & emotion in a sport context, they become better prepared to thrive in school and beyond.Join me each week as I help people reach peak performance and maximum enjoyment.

  • How to Talk to Your Athlete About Their Sport Without Adding Pressure or Stress
    Jul 8 2025

    This week on the PerformHappy Podcast, I’m talking directly to sport parents (but athletes, don’t tune out just yet!). I had two parents in our community share the same concern: “I don’t want to say the wrong thing.” They love their kids, they want to help, but they’re afraid they might accidentally be making things worse.

    So in this episode, I’m sharing what I’ve learned about how to actually support your athlete, without adding pressure, without creating shutdowns, and without walking on eggshells.

    This is something I dive deep into in my Peak Performance Parenting course, but today I’m giving you the Reader’s Digest version so you can start building trust, connection, and resilience with your athlete right away.

    Whether you're a parent wondering how to be encouraging without pushing too hard, or an athlete who just wants to feel understood, this conversation is for you.

    In this episode, Coach Rebecca talks about:

    • The different stages of change, and why “helpful” advice doesn’t always land
    • How to know when your athlete is ready to talk, and when it’s better to just listen
    • Why open-ended questions (not lectures!) are your best tool
    • How to become your athlete’s safe space, even when they’re struggling
    • Ways to build trust outside of sports conversations
    • Why empathy goes further than problem-solving
    “When in doubt, do less. Your job is food, hugs, rides, and tuition. That’s it. Let the rest be about connection, not correction.” – Coach Rebecca

  • Should I Quit? 4 Questions Every Athlete Should Ask Themselves
    Jun 30 2025

    This week on the PerformHappy Podcast, Coach Rebecca dives into a powerful Q&A session centered around one of the most difficult crossroads in an athlete’s journey—deciding whether to keep going or walk away from their sport. Whether you’re deep in upgrade season, dreading practice, or feeling the spark fade, this episode offers clarity and compassion for athletes (and their parents) navigating burnout, fear, and identity.

    Coach Rebecca shares personal stories from her own gymnastics career, candid conversations with athletes, and the key questions every gymnast should ask before making a decision they might regret—or celebrate.

    Whether you're the athlete considering a change, or the parent watching your child wrestle with uncertainty, this episode is a must-listen.

    In this episode, Coach Rebecca talks about:

    • What to do if you’re falling out of love with your sport
    • The difference between burnout and being truly done
    • How fear, pain, or pressure can cloud your decision-making
    • Why it’s okay to redefine what your gymnastics journey looks like
    • Four essential questions to ask before making a choice to stay or go
    • How to create your own version of success (even if it doesn’t include leveling up)
    • Tools for finding clarity—especially if college recruiting pressure is weighing you down
    “If you had no pain, no fear, and no deadlines… would you still love your sport? That answer tells you everything.” – Coach Rebecca
